Mark Peterson was born in London and studied Literature at the University of Essex. Mark then worked in PR before choosing to re-train as a teacher. He returned to university in 2006 to begin an MA in Creative Writing. It was there that he started to write the novel that would become Flesh and Blood, the first in the Minter series. He now lives in Brighton with his wife and two children.

Résumé
A second stunning Brighton-set crime novel featuring DS Minter, from one of the sharpest new voices in British crime writing. On the surface, John Slade appeared quite normal. But when Martin, a young biochemist, ran a behavioural experiment, he discovered a boy without inhibitions or moral qualms: the perfect subject for a series of experiments Martin had never dared try... Twenty years later, Brighton is facing a serial killer.
DS Minter investigates the most bizarre and disturbing murder of his career; the dismembered body of a local woman dumped on a station platform. And when another body is found, Minter realises he is hunting a brutal killer with an IQ off the scale, the likes of which the city has never seen.
